    The idea apparently really is to play a Studio Ghibli game, and that's enough for me.

    It's about a kid (of course) whose mother dies, but not before giving him a doll that he turns into a fairy with his tears who then enables the boy to travel to another reality with a magical book. Or something like that. Beyond that I'm not sure. It's been awhile since I've gone looking for information on it, there may be a lot more out there than there was before.

    The battle system is supposedly rather complex in contrast to the cartoon graphics, but from what I recall, the JP DS version used some kind of drawing mechanism for the magic, and I'm not sure how this will translate to PS3.

    The music should be awesome, though, Ghibli used their in-house guy who scored Howl's Moving Castle, Kiki's Delivery Service, Spirited Away, et al.
